Had a great experience with Essex Imports in Salinas, CA. Former colleague of my previous Jag Shop (Craig Nelson) in Portland.
Both Jag Master Techs, 30 years in business.

Shop's nothing fancy, but he's always busy, works on a variety of high end makes, knows older Jag's well, services many locals who show at the annual Concourse, does good work at fair prices, and his British accent is fun too.
